Ah. Okay, I understand now. The PyDO connection object is just a proxy 
to a real connection object (optionally via a connection pool). This 
makes more sense to me now (thanks for the explanation).

I take it one should avoid accessing the underlying connection object 
(e.g., via o.getDBI().conn) unless one really knows what one is 
doing....

On Aug 13, 2005, at 08:36, Jacob Smullyan wrote:

> On Sat, Aug 13, 2005 at 07:43:36AM -0700, Matthew Bogosian wrote:
>> Does this mean that one cannot call commit() or rollback() more than
>> once on a given connection?
>
> If you've done so, why do you care whether the connection you have
> after committing or rolling back is the same connection, or a
> different one?  The transaction is over.  For it to matter, the
> connection would need to have some state that you want to preserve
> across transaction boundaries.  I don't see anything in your example
> that would be a problem.
>
> The dbi object's "conn" attribute auto-vivifies.  If the connection is
> returned to the pool, the next time you need it another equivalent one
> is there.
>
> With mysql, if insert_id() is connection-specific state, that would
> break with autocommit (which I still haven't had time to fix, sorry)
> and maybe even without it, if you tried to call insert_id() after a
> commit:
>
>    o=obj.new()
>    o.commit()
>    # what happens?
>    print o.getDBI().conn.insert_id()
